Martijn Konings is Professor of Political Economy and Social Theory at the University of Sydney. He is the author of The Development of American Finance (2011), The Emotional Logic of Capitalism (2015), Neoliberalism (with Damien Cahill, 2017), Capital and Time: For a New Critique of Neoliberal reason (2018), and The Asset Economy (with Lisa Adkins and Melinda Cooper, 2020). He is currently working on a book on the politics of asset inflation. He is also the co-editor of the book series Currencies: New Thinking for Financial Times. at Stanford University Press. During the 2021-22 academic year he holds a fellowship at the Berggruen Institute in Los Angeles.
